#668BBC Hex Color Code

#668BBC

The Hexadecimal Color #668BBC is a contrast shade of Steel Blue. #668BBC RGB value is rgb(102, 139, 188). RGB Color Model of #668BBC consists of 40% red, 54% green and 73% blue. HSL color Mode of #668BBC has 214°(degrees) Hue, 39% Saturation and 57% Lightness. #668BBC color has an wavelength of 485.25926n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#668BBC is #9999CC.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#668BBC is #68B. The Closest Color to #668BBC is #4682B4. Official Name of #668BBC Hex Code is Ship Cove.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#668BBC is 46 Cyan 26 Magenta 0 Yellow 26 Black and #668BBC CMY is 46, 26, 0. HSLA (Hue Saturation Lightness Alpha) of #668BBC is hsl(214,39,57, 1.0) and HSV is hsv(214, 46, 74). A Three-Dimensional XYZ value of #668BBC is 23.79, 24.92, 51.12.
Hex8 Value of #668BBC is #668BBCFF. Decimal Value of #668BBC is 6720444 and Octal Value of #668BBC is 31505674. Binary Value of #668BBC is 1100110, 10001011, 10111100 and Android of #668BBC is 4284910524 / 0xff668bbc. The Horseshoe Shaped Chromaticity Diagram xyY of #668BBC is 0.238, 0.25, 0.25 and YIQ Color Space of #668BBC is 133.523, -37.792, 7.4233. The Color Space LMS (Long Medium Short) of #668BBC is 19.84, 25.87, 50.68. CieLAB (L*a*b*) of #668BBC is 57.0, 0.46, -29.59. CieLUV : LCHuv (L*, u*, v*) of #668BBC is 57.0, -18.61, -45.4. The cylindrical version of CieLUV is known as CieLCH : LCHab of #668BBC is 57.0, 29.59, 270.89. Hunter Lab variable of #668BBC is 49.92, -2.29, -25.77.

Various Color Shades of #668BBC

To get 25% Saturated #668BBC Color, you need to convert the hex color #668BBC to the HSL (Hue, Saturation, Lightness) color space, increase the saturation value by 25%, and then convert it back to the hex color. To desaturate a color by 25%, we need to reduce its saturation level while keeping the same hue and lightness. Saturation represents the intensity or vividness of a color. A 100% saturation means the color is fully vivid, while a 0% saturation results in a shade of gray. To make a color 25% darker or 25% lighter, you need to reduce the intensity of each of its RGB (Red, Green, Blue) components by 25% or increase it to 25%. Inverting a #668BBC hex color involves converting each of its RGB (Red, Green, Blue) components to their complementary values. The complementary color is found by subtracting each component's value from the maximum value of 255.

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#668BBC

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
